Overview
The SI4468-A2A-IM is a high-performance, low-current wireless transceiver part of the EZRadioPRO family, designed for sub-GHz ISM band applications. It offers an exceptional output power of up to +20 dBm and a sensitivity of -133 dBm, enabling long-range communication links with a maximum data rate of 1 Mbps. Operating across a wide frequency range of 142 MHz to 1.05 GHz, this transceiver is optimized for battery-powered systems requiring reliable, low-latency connectivity.
Why Choose This Part
The SI4468 stands out for its high integration, featuring an 11-bit ADC, temperature sensor, and low battery detector within a compact 4x4 mm QFN package. It provides best-in-class sensitivity and a significant link budget of up to 153 dB, allowing for extended range without external amplifiers. Engineers benefit from extremely low power modes, including a 30 nA shutdown current and 10 mA receive current, maximizing the operational life of portable devices.

Getting Started
Developers should use the Silicon Labs Wireless Development Suite (WDS) to generate configuration headers for the SPI interface. For hardware evaluation, the 4468CPCE20C915 series of pico boards can be used with the main development platform to test range and power consumption. Ensure proper matching network design for the 20 dBm output to comply with regional regulatory limits.
